Title: "Asura in the 249th Cave of Mogao: A Mythological Allegory from the 6th Century" The captivating image before you is a testament to the rich cultural heritage of Central Asian art, specifically from the 249th cave of Mogao in Dunhuang, China, dating back to the 6th century during the Western Wei Dynasty. This masterpiece, now preserved in the Mogao Caves, portrays an intriguing allegory featuring an Asura, a mythical being from Indian and Buddhist mythology. Asura, depicted in this painting, is a powerful and often mischievous deity, known for their immense strength and magical abilities. In Buddhist mythology, they are often portrayed as antagonists, challenging the Buddha or other celestial beings. However, in this painting, the Asura is shown in a more benign light, perhaps symbolizing the transformation of negative energies into positive ones. The 249th cave, adorned with vibrant frescoes, is part of the Thousand Buddha Grottoes,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. These caves, discovered in the late 19th century, are a treasure trove of ancient art and history, reflecting the diverse cultural influences that shaped the region. The painting showcases the Asura in a dynamic pose, with muscular arms and a fierce expression, yet his body is adorned with intricate patterns and jewelry, indicating his divine status. The use of rich colors and bold brushstrokes adds to the painting's visual appeal and conveys the artist's mastery of the medium. This painting is a reminder of the profound impact of mythology and allegory in ancient art, as well as the enduring influence of Central Asian culture on the artistic traditions of China and beyond. The Asura in the 249th cave of Mogao is not just a work of art, but a window into the past, offering insights into the beliefs, values, and artistic sensibilities of a bygone era.
